roadrunner sports stores in Alpharetta, Georgia on Map
roadrunner sports store locations in Alpharetta (Georgia)
More roadrunner sports stores in Georgia - GA
roadrunner sports stores located in Alpharetta: 1
Largest shopping mall with roadrunner sports store in Alpharetta: Avalon
roadrunner sports store locator Alpharetta displays complete list and huge database of roadrunner sports stores, factory stores, shops and boutiques in Alpharetta (Georgia). roadrunner sports information: map of Alpharetta, shopping hours, contact information.
More roadrunner sports stores in Georgia - GA
Search all roadrunner sports stores located in Alpharetta, Georgia